mysql默认字符编码,mysql默认字符集用命令怎么设置
- 数据库
- 2023-09-02
- 76
MySQL设置默认编码集为utf8怎么设置 在[mysqld]下添加 default-character-set=utf8(mysql 5 版本添加character-...
MySQL设置默认编码集为utf8怎么设置
在[mysqld]下添加 default-character-set=utf8(mysql 5 版本添加character-set-server=utf8)在[client]下添加 default-character-set=utf8 这样我们建数据库建表的时候就不用特别指定utf8的字符集了。
就是你在建表的时候,在字段后面,追加设置为utf8。
UTF-8是UTF-8编码是一种目前广泛应用于网页的编码,它其实是一种Unicode编码,即致力于把全球所有语言纳入一个统一的编码。前UTF-8已经把几种重要的亚洲语言纳入,包括简繁中文和日韩文字。
connection = utf8 ; mysql SET collation_database = utf8 ; mysql SET collation_server = utf8 ; 一般就算设置了表的mysql默认字符集为utf8并且通过UTF-8编码发送查询,你会发现存入数据库的仍然是乱码。
如何设置Mysql数据库默认的字符集编码为GBK
1、windows-Preferences...打开首选项对话框,左侧导航树,导航到general-Workspace,右侧 Text file encoding,选择Other,改变为 utf-8(必须小写),以后新建立工程其属性对话框中的Text file encoding即为UTF-8。
2、修改mysql的默认字符集是通过修改它的配置文件来实现的。
3、你好!两种方法:修改服务器字符集为gbk,然后创建数据库让其继承服务器gbk字符集 创建数据库时指定字符集为gbk 详见参考资料 如果对你有帮助,望采纳。
4、打开my.cnf后,在文件内的[mysqld]下增加如下两行设置:character_set_server=utf8 init_connect=SET NAMES utf8然后保存退出。
5、首先换数据库,MySQL处理这个数量级数据比较吃力。
6、mysql 创建 数据库时指定编码很重要,很多开发者都使用了默认编码,乱码问题可是防不胜防。制定数据库的编码可以很大程度上避免倒入导出带来的乱码问题。网页数据一般采用UTF8编码,而数据库默认为latin 。
如何修改windows下mysql的字符集
windows-Preferences...打开首选项对话框,左侧导航树,导航到general-Workspace,右侧 Text file encoding,选择Other,改变为 utf-8(必须小写),以后新建立工程其属性对话框中的Text file encoding即为UTF-8。
批量修改mysql表字符集的方法:更改表编码(字符集):ALTER TABLE TABLE_NAME D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ci;如果一个数据库有很多表要修改,如果没有好的办法是非常头疼而且是费时间的。
所以要注意在将 MySQL字符集 utf8 改为 utf8mb4 时,一定要注意 collation_server 也要同时修改!干脆将 default-character-set=utf8mb4 也改成了算了。
修改mysql的默认字符集是通过修改它的配置文件来实现的。
table `w`default character set utf8;或者alter table tbl_name convert to character set charset_name;但是发现其中一个字段content的字符集还是gbk。
如何修改MySQL字符集
php设置mysql字符集的方法:可以利用mysqli_set_charset()函数来设置。该函数用来规定当与数据库服务器进行数据传送时要使用的字符集,如果成功则返回true,如果失败则返回false。
只对本次会话有效。SET NAMES utf8;直接修改 my.cnf,[client]和[MySQLd]下面各增加一行内容,然后重启 MySQL,全局生效。
也改成了算了。最后的字符配置如下:[mysql]default-character-set=utf8mb4init_connect=set names utf8mb4[mysqld]character_set_server=utf8mb4collation_server=utf8mb4_bin修改之后,启动成功。
修改mysql的默认字符集是通过修改它的配置文件来实现的。
如何通过命令修改mysql数据库默认编码为gb2312
1、我们可以通过命令查看数据库当前编码:mysql SHOW VARIABLES LIKE character%;发现很多对应的都是 latin1,我们的目标就是在下次使用此命令时latin1能被UTF8取代。
2、所以还是可能出现乱码。建议修改一下,删除表重建,在开始就统一编码。
3、就是编码问题,办法很简单,在连接数据库代码之后和将要插入数据的代码之前加上mysql_query(set names gb2312);这行代码就可以了。
4、和用户的程序文件的编码方式、用户程序和MySQL数据库的连接方式都有关系。
本文链接:http://xinin56.com/su/14465.html